Universum Mortuus Machina
Christian Älvestam, I've never liked any of the bands he's been in where he's used clean vocals (eg. Scar Symmetry, Miseration, Solution .45). When I heard that he was making a guest appearance on 'Mortuus Machina' I have to say, I expected the album to take a hit and be absolutely crap. I put my hands up though, the vocals aren't that bad on this album. The cleans are only on a few songs and that helps the album overall as it gives it a bit of variety. Even the song with the power metal style vocals isn't too bad and I'm not a fan of those style vocals at all. As for the musicianship, it's of a high standard. There's no one song that really stands out, mainly because each track on this album is of an excellent quality. I'd even go as far as stating 'Mortuus Machina' is one of the stronger melo-death albums of 2010.
